    Fire Ecology YBN513 FALL-SPRING 3+0 Fac./ Uni. E 6
    Learning Outcomes
    1-Exemplifies on general conceptual terminology of fire ecology.
    2-Identifies the natural role of fires.
    3-Exemplifies on the post-fire regeneration techniques and their effects.
    4-Lists the stages of preparing fire risk map.

    Goals The aim of this course is to learning of the knowledge on properties of fire regimes and fires in natural ecosystems, the knowledge on fire-prone ecosystems and fire-adaptations of plant species found in these ecosystems, the knowledge on the relationship between fire and plant and animal diversity, the knowledge on fire management concept.
    Content General concepts of fire ecology, The role of fires in natural ecosystems, Post-fire regeneration of plant and animal populations, Fire adaptations of plant species.
